Loaded with four cheeses,
ricotta, Parmesan, cheddar and mozzarilla, this pizza is a winner
with young and old alike. - Recipe by Diane Halferty of Corpus
Christi, Texas.
All
My Cheeses Four Cheese Pizza
- 1 cup ricotta cheese
1/2 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
2 tablespoons chopped fresh basil or 1 teaspoon dried basil
2 tablespoons minced fresh garlic
1/2 tablespoons sal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ground pepper
1 prepared 12-inch pizza crust
1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
1 cup diced tomato
Additional fresh basil, chopped for garnish
- Preheat oven to 450°F
(230°C).
- In a small bowl, combine
ricotta, Parmesan, basil, garlic, salt and pepper.
- Place pizza crust on a
cookie sheet and top evenly with mixture. Sprinkle with remaining
cheeses.
- Bake pizza until golden,
about 10 to 12 minutes.
- Cool slightly; sprinkle
with tomatoes and additional chopped basil.
Makes 4 servings.
